How to prepare for a job interview at VanWonen
✨Know Your Fishing Stuff
Brush up on your fishing knowledge before the interview. Be ready to discuss different types of tackle, bait, and techniques. Showing your passion for fishing will impress the interviewers and demonstrate that you’re a great fit for the team.
✨Show Off Your Customer Service Skills
Prepare examples of how you've provided exceptional customer service in the past. Think about times when you went the extra mile for a customer or helped someone find exactly what they needed. This will highlight your ability to create an inviting shopping environment.
✨Dress the Part
While it’s important to be comfortable, make sure you dress smartly for the interview. A neat appearance shows that you take the opportunity seriously and respect the company’s image. Plus, it sets a positive tone for your first impression.
✨Ask Thoughtful Questions
Prepare some questions to ask at the end of the interview. Inquire about the team culture, training opportunities, or how success is measured in the role. This shows your genuine interest in the position and helps you determine if it’s the right fit for you.
